[PULL,30/43] target/ppc/POWER9: Direct all instr and data storage interrupts to the hypv

The vpm0 bit was removed from the LPCR in POWER9, this bit controlled
whether ISI and DSI interrupts were directed to the hypervisor or the
partition. These interrupts now go to the hypervisor irrespective, thus
it is no longer necessary to check the vmp0 bit in the LPCR.

diff --git a/target/ppc/mmu-hash64.c b/target/ppc/mmu-hash64.c
index c09255d..76669ed 100644
--- a/target/ppc/mmu-hash64.c
+++ b/target/ppc/mmu-hash64.c
@@ -652,7 +652,15 @@  static void ppc_hash64_set_isi(CPUState *cs, CPUPPCState *env,
     if (msr_ir) {
         vpm = !!(env->spr[SPR_LPCR] & LPCR_VPM1);
     } else {
-        vpm = !!(env->spr[SPR_LPCR] & LPCR_VPM0);
+        switch (env->mmu_model) {
+        case POWERPC_MMU_3_00:
+            /* Field deprecated in ISAv3.00 - interrupts always go to hyperv */
+            vpm = true;
+            break;
+        default:
+            vpm = !!(env->spr[SPR_LPCR] & LPCR_VPM0);
+            break;
+        }
     }
     if (vpm && !msr_hv) {
         cs->exception_index = POWERPC_EXCP_HISI;
@@ -670,7 +678,15 @@  static void ppc_hash64_set_dsi(CPUState *cs, CPUPPCState *env, uint64_t dar,
     if (msr_dr) {
         vpm = !!(env->spr[SPR_LPCR] & LPCR_VPM1);
     } else {
-        vpm = !!(env->spr[SPR_LPCR] & LPCR_VPM0);
+        switch (env->mmu_model) {
+        case POWERPC_MMU_3_00:
+            /* Field deprecated in ISAv3.00 - interrupts always go to hyperv */
+            vpm = true;
+            break;
+        default:
+            vpm = !!(env->spr[SPR_LPCR] & LPCR_VPM0);
+            break;
+        }
     }
     if (vpm && !msr_hv) {
         cs->exception_index = POWERPC_EXCP_HDSI;
